Answer:

36cm²

Explanation:

Perimeter of a square = 4x (sum of all 4 sides)

Perimeter = 24 cm (given)

\implies4x = 24

x = 24/4 = 6 cm

Now, area of a square = (side)²

Area = (6)²

= 36 cm²

Why do you think that plants have both Chloroplasts AND mitochondria?
LuckyWell [14K]

Answer:

Explanation:

ells need both chloroplasts and mitochondria to undergo both photosynthesis AND cell respiration. After photosynthesis, which chloroplasts are needed for, which yields oxygen and glucose, plants need to break down the glucose and they use cell respiration to do this, which happens in the mitochondria.
